Package: clang-21-doc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 13236 Depends: libjs-mathjax Multi-Arch: foreign Homepage: https://www.llvm.org/ Priority: optional Section: doc Filename: pool/main/l/llvm-toolchain-21/clang-21-doc_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 4037296 SHA256: 9bd205ea4f738784bd3c69f9946fa29cc9abd3ace9237aa451b36bbc7ace7b67 SHA1: 58e4add789d624ee9a3c237db250973b1b0c2203 MD5sum: e198a33ea70a29583c24ca684e1ffc1b Description: C, C++ and Objective-C compiler - Documentation Clang project is a C, C++, Objective C and Objective C++ front-end based on the LLVM compiler. Its goal is to offer a replacement to the GNU Compiler Collection (GCC). . Clang implements all of the ISO C++ 1998, 11, 14 and 17 standards and also provides most of the support of C++20. . This package contains the documentation. Package: clang-21-examples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 92 Multi-Arch: foreign Homepage: https://www.llvm.org/ Priority: optional Section: doc Filename: pool/main/l/llvm-toolchain-21/clang-21-examples_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 60716 SHA256: 3f193312014084b79486aba7c4fee9457d9170a72a9db4fc86c47a912fafe747 SHA1: be083f749fcbff79220f92ba2d699e9a7e501026 MD5sum: d9573ed214c89053f776e6333146c2e1 Description: Clang examples Clang project is a C, C++, Objective C and Objective C++ front-end based on the LLVM compiler. Its goal is to offer a replacement to the GNU Compiler Collection (GCC). . Clang implements all of the ISO C++ 1998, 11, 14 and 17 standards and also provides most of the support of C++20. . This package contains the Clang examples. Package: libc++-21-dev-wasm32 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 16104 Depends: wasi-libc, libc++abi-21-dev-wasm32 Conflicts: libc++-x.y-dev-wasm32 Replaces: libc++-x.y-dev-wasm32 Provides: libc++-x.y-dev-wasm32 Multi-Arch: foreign Homepage: https://www.llvm.org/ Priority: optional Section: libdevel Filename: pool/main/l/llvm-toolchain-21/libc++-21-dev-wasm32_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 1676468 SHA256: e7d51184e8b749b97e2cc05342a1fd055be2251acb9193f219e8a3a3a7427587 SHA1: 4dc97fe5645d4a84d89fd6004f0719304c832587 MD5sum: f2ea7e4d67e7cfe947d1ec6b1e3c4497 Description: LLVM C++ Standard library (WASI) libc++ is another implementation of the C++ standard library . Features and Goals . * Correctness as defined by the C++ standards. * Fast execution. * Minimal memory use. * Fast compile times. * ABI compatibility with gcc's libstdc++ for some low-level features such as exception objects, rtti and memory allocation. * Extensive unit tests. . This package provides a version for the 32-bit WebAssembly System Interface. Package: libc++abi-21-dev-wasm32 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 766 Depends: wasi-libc Conflicts: libc++abi-x.y-dev-wasm32 Replaces: libc++abi-x.y-dev-wasm32 Provides: libc++abi-x.y-dev-wasm32 Multi-Arch: foreign Homepage: https://www.llvm.org/ Priority: optional Section: libdevel Filename: pool/main/l/llvm-toolchain-21/libc++abi-21-dev-wasm32_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 217636 SHA256: 556a1d027c93fc818267b1fda1aaf0dc79f8f5e56598f25ba30b9dc5b0a53c0d SHA1: b5b08b3471794f1980fbcca08d6e34600ac032b9 MD5sum: 9708e8752aaa2038638277d7abc17b1e Description: LLVM low level support for a standard C++ library (WASI) libc++abi is another implementation of low level support for a standard C++ library. . Features and Goals . * Correctness as defined by the C++ standards. * Provide a portable sublayer to ease the porting of libc++ . This package provides a version for the 32-bit WebAssembly System Interface. Package: libclang-rt-21-dev-wasm32 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 311 Multi-Arch: foreign Homepage: https://www.llvm.org/ Priority: optional Section: libdevel Filename: pool/main/l/llvm-toolchain-21/libclang-rt-21-dev-wasm32_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 91892 SHA256: 9c45d999b5170f1fc68bd1406da1671d15f1f521b27ae34c2b7aaae6e65f48e1 SHA1: 39ceeca31806626cb361c49949b3501f5b275c71 MD5sum: 7c722fd408c2b073727e6895206d0bbd Description: Compiler-rt - wasm32 builtins Provides the compiler-rt builtins for WebAssembly 32 bits Package: libclang-rt-21-dev-wasm64 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 318 Multi-Arch: foreign Homepage: https://www.llvm.org/ Priority: optional Section: libdevel Filename: pool/main/l/llvm-toolchain-21/libclang-rt-21-dev-wasm64_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 92168 SHA256: 895b7527adc9548b653e980a591aa90cb2922495ff0b732d06e9ccf794846d83 SHA1: eb3298a34bb4ee17bdd9f81a1935d0b8af36721b MD5sum: 75fd02930089a8b35c73ed69a259b85c Description: Compiler-rt - wasm64 builtins Provides the compiler-rt builtins for WebAssembly 64 bits Package: libclang-rt-21-dev-win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 916 Multi-Arch: foreign Homepage: https://www.llvm.org/ Priority: optional Section: libdevel Filename: pool/main/l/llvm-toolchain-21/libclang-rt-21-dev-win_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 170320 SHA256: 8cb73ea9d528d5c8242c4d61fa2f4ea4de6419b5217dd227b72b76f2519513dc SHA1: 9e828b259bbdbafa8b783d9bdb0458b6a940c4cf MD5sum: 00b50d011e4304cad5c2f7e52e535fde Description: Compiler-rt - Windows builtins Provides the compiler-rt builtins for Windows Package: libclc-21 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 53026 Depends: libclc-21-dev (= 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50), libclang-common-21-dev Conflicts: libclc-x.y Breaks: libclc-amdgcn, libclc-ptx, libclc-r600 Replaces: libclc-amdgcn, libclc-ptx, libclc-r600, libclc-x.y Provides: libclc-x.y Multi-Arch: foreign Homepage: https://www.llvm.org/ Priority: optional Section: libs Filename: pool/main/l/llvm-toolchain-21/libclc-21_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 7163380 SHA256: 2423a3a568c34f595babad2d1fd05302a2a66b04b45726554238c67981bfc137 SHA1: c3bf6ff08c70bc60781b5029e017b1b41ac84f6d MD5sum: ec36c7451718784cfe5b0587271e31fb Description: OpenCL C language implementation - platform support libclc is an open implementation of the OpenCL C programming language, as specified by the OpenCL 1.1 Specification. . This package contains support for the amdgcn (AMD GPU), PTX and r600 platforms. Package: libclc-21-dev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 67 Conflicts: libclc-x.y-dev Breaks: libclc-dev Replaces: libclc-dev, libclc-x.y-dev Provides: libclc-x.y-dev Multi-Arch: foreign Homepage: https://www.llvm.org/ Priority: optional Section: libdevel Filename: pool/main/l/llvm-toolchain-21/libclc-21-dev_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 52156 SHA256: a073a95cc86d5689cb6c6e05da1e69538bc9902107dacc5fbf09f99421f96734 SHA1: 2ddab587070cdb35abc5490f77ee14ba90c78c38 MD5sum: 91951efde9fcc4cb862d6dd492489ea3 Description: OpenCL C language implementation - development files libclc is an open implementation of the OpenCL C programming language, as specified by the OpenCL 1.1 Specification. . This package contains development header files. Package: libomp-21-doc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 14951 Depends: libjs-jquery Breaks: libiomp-x.y-doc Replaces: libiomp-x.y-doc Multi-Arch: foreign Homepage: https://www.llvm.org/ Priority: optional Section: doc Filename: pool/main/l/llvm-toolchain-21/libomp-21-doc_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 1090096 SHA256: 32a086c21daacec184ede65805e31fb62a261bfc2fc0b0cd595cbad8c33ace60 SHA1: eb9830d1790858483cb70bb8c9dd2cc3bfcc8113 MD5sum: 3a64f5c69d160c787207338f1b6670ae Description: LLVM OpenMP runtime - Documentation The runtime is the part of the OpenMP implementation that your code is linked against, and that manages the multiple threads in an OpenMP program while it is executing. . This package contains the documentation of this package. Package: llvm-21-doc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 59876 Depends: libjs-jquery, libjs-underscore Multi-Arch: foreign Homepage: https://www.llvm.org/ Priority: optional Section: doc Filename: pool/main/l/llvm-toolchain-21/llvm-21-doc_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 10051508 SHA256: b2868e450ea7082b004b3e870df04c045b8b7c159c5f913cd6d654b7136cf1ab SHA1: eb70112ea9f1b57aaaf1a0f2530bba35e8fa15ff MD5sum: 5337ec70024531b014e186661910a0bb Description: Modular compiler and toolchain technologies, documentation LLVM is a collection of libraries and tools that make it easy to build compilers, optimizers, just-in-time code generators, and many other compiler-related programs. . LLVM uses a single, language-independent virtual instruction set both as an offline code representation (to communicate code between compiler phases and to run-time systems) and as the compiler internal representation (to analyze and transform programs). This persistent code representation allows a common set of sophisticated compiler techniques to be applied at compile-time, link-time, install-time, run-time, or "idle-time" (between program runs). . This package contains all documentation (extensive). Package: llvm-21-examples Source: llvm-toolchain-21 Version: 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50 Architecture: all Maintainer: LLVM Packaging Team Installed-Size: 477 Depends: llvm-21-dev (>= 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50), llvm-21-dev (<< 1:21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50+c~) Homepage: https://www.llvm.org/ Priority: optional Section: doc Filename: pool/main/l/llvm-toolchain-21/llvm-21-examples_21.1.8~++20251221033036+2078da43e25a-1~exp1~20251221153213.50_all.deb Size: 291000 SHA256: dbb70561a407af907be65187f70573bb98ec2ce97f5147323740609504143878 SHA1: 80046c66c63fc3a2dbdb740ca571ccb082bc9137 MD5sum: bc9f402b0e9bb4320ec4de7e0a198c8a Description: Modular compiler and toolchain technologies, examples LLVM is a collection of libraries and tools that make it easy to build compilers, optimizers, just-in-time code generators, and many other compiler-related programs. . LLVM uses a single, language-independent virtual instruction set both as an offline code representation (to communicate code between compiler phases and to run-time systems) and as the compiler internal representation (to analyze and transform programs). This persistent code representation allows a common set of sophisticated compiler techniques to be applied at compile-time, link-time, install-time, run-time, or "idle-time" (between program runs). . This package contains examples for using LLVM, both in developing extensions to LLVM and in using it to compile code.